China's recent decision to impose stricter regulations on rare earth exports is raising concerns in the global market, particularly among technology companies that rely heavily on these materials. This move could disrupt supply chains and increase prices, impacting various industries from electronics to renewable energy. As China controls a significant portion of the world's rare earth resources, this clampdown may lead to heightened tensions and competition for alternative sources, making it a critical issue for global economic stability.
